Ir para conteúdo
  • Cadastre-se

Italo Giurizzato Junior

Consultores
  • Total de ítens

    38.759
  • Registro em

  • Última visita

  • Days Won

    1.107

Tudo que Italo Giurizzato Junior postou

  1. Boa tarde Anadilson, Com exceção do ConsultarSituacao os demais métodos de consulta retornam o XML da NFS-e e automaticamente popula o componente com as informações do mesmo. Sendo assim você pode fazer o seguinte: if ACBrNFSeX1.NotasFiscais.Items[i].NFSe.SituacaoNfse = snCancelado then (...) else (...)
  2. Boa tarde, E se enviar o CNAE com apenas 7 dígitos, o webservice rejeita o Rps?
  3. Boa tarde Marcelo, Você não pode comparar o XML do Rps com o de envio de Lote. Se você prestar atenção vai notar que o XML do Rps esta dentro do grupo <ListaRps> que faz parte do XML de envio do Lote. Ao informar o código do item da lista de serviço faça o seguinte: NFSe.Servico.ItemServico[i].ItemListaServico := '1401'; Veja se isso resolve.
  4. Boa tarde Sandro, Para mim, trata-se de um erro do lado deles.
  5. Boa tarde Amparo, Segundo o Manual versão 7.03 - Visão Geral item 6.3 - página 125 que trata sobre a distribuição da NF-e costa o seguinte: No caso de troca de arquivo entre as empresas, é sugerida a adoção do nome do arquivo como segue: <999...999>-procNFe.xml Onde: • <999...999>: corresponde a Chave de Acesso da NF-e; • “-procNFe”: identifica o processamento do documento autorizado. O componente ACBrNFe adota a seguinte nomenclatura: <chave de acesso>-nfe.xml Note que o Manual não impõe uma regra, apenas da uma sugestão. No meu entendimento a chave é mais completa pois contem o numero da nota, o CNPJ do emitente, Ano e Mês de emissão. Obrigar os seus fornecedores a enviar o XML segundo a nomenclatura que consta no manual, isso você não pode, mas acredito que uma boa conversa quem sabe você consegue.
  6. Boa tarde, Já inclui na minha lista de tarefas para analisar o problema. TK-2371
  7. Bom dia Wilson, Muito obrigado pela colaboração e testes, entre hoje e amanhã estarei enviando para o SVN.
  8. Bom dia Marcos, Com relação a data de cancelamento, realmente esta em um formato que não é esperado, sugiro entrar em contato com o provedor para sanar o problema. Se não resolver peça para os seus clientes protocolar na prefeitura um documento expondo os problemas, desta forma a coisa vai andar mais rápido. Ao cancelar esse status 200, não se trata de um erro e sim um código que diz que a nota foi cancelada.
  9. Bom dia Danio, Muito obrigado pela colaboração, já inclui na minha lista de tarefas. TK-2367
  10. Bom dia Tiago, Os seus fontes estão desatualizados, favor atualizar novamente e reinstale o ACBr e repita os testes.
  11. Wilson, Analisando o código na Unit SigISS.GravarXml temos o seguinte: Result.AppendChild(AddNode(tcStr, '#2', 'cnpj', 1, 14, 1, OnlyNumber(NFSe.Prestador.IdentificacaoPrestador.CpfCnpj), '')); Result.AppendChild(AddNode(tcStr, '#2', 'cpf', 1, 14, 1, OnlyNumber(Usuario), '')); Result.AppendChild(AddNode(tcStr, '#2', 'senha', 1, 10, 1, Senha, DSC_SENHA)); Note que já existe a linha que gera o CPF, a propriedade Usuario recebe o conteúdo da propriedade de configuração WSUser. Neste caso basta informar o CPF do usuário em WSUser. Com relação a tag <incentivo_fiscal> note que ela se encontra na mesma function da tag <cpf>, ou seja: function TNFSeW_SigISS103.GerarIdentificacaoRPS: TACBrXmlNode; Essa unit possui 2 function GerarIdentificacaoRPS, essa que esta você esta propondo alterações se refere ao SigISS103, a versão 1.03 até o momento é utilizado somente pela cidade de Londrina, portanto poderíamos em um primeiro momento comentar a geração da tag <incentivo_fiscal>. O dia que aparecer outra cidade que também usa a versão 1.03, mas tem que gerar a tag, buscamos uma outra solução para o problema.
  12. Bom dia Wilson, Muito obrigado pela colaboração, já inclui na minha lista de tarefas. TK-2366 Essas alterações na unit GravarXml é exclusivo para a cidade de Londrina?
  13. Bom dia Barrys, Já esta no SVN.
  14. Bom dia, Muito obrigado pela colaboração, já inclui na minha lista de tarefas. TK-2365
  15. Bom dia, Como lhe disse na postagem anterior não conheço muito bem o Reinf, apenas ajudei na implementação do componente. Não tenho nenhuma aplicação que utiliza o componente Reinf. Não conheço o fluxo do Reinf, logo a minha ajuda é muito limitada. Acredito que você vai precisar conversar com um bom contador que entenda muito bem do Reinf, quem sabe ele pode lhe ajudar. E até entrar em contato com a Receita (acho que é ela a responsável por recepcionar o Reinf) e obter maiores esclarecimentos sobre o problema que você esta enfrentando.
  16. Boa tarde, Notei que no envio do evento R-2099 foi informado a Inscrição: 01000148 Ao realizar a consulta foi informado a inscrição: 30714745 Você sabe me dizer o porque? Eu não conheço o Reinf, mas não deveria ser a mesma Inscrição?
  17. Boa tarde, Favor atualizar os fontes e faça novos testes.
  18. Boa tarde, Antes de executar o LoadFromFile esta sendo executado o Clear? ACBrNFSeX1.NotasFiscais.Clear; ACBrNFSeX1.NotasFiscais.LoadFromFile(OpenDialog1.FileName, False); ACBrNFSeX1.NotasFiscais.Imprimir;
  19. Boa tarde Anadison, Fiz uma alteração que acredito vai resolver o problema do pedido de cancelamento. Realize um novo teste com a unit em anexo. Tinus.Provider.pas
  20. Boa tarde Marcelo, Já esta no SVN as novas cidades. Favor anexar o XML de envio do lote para que eu possa analisar.
  21. Boa tarde Roger, Se a propriedade de configuração AtualizarXMLCancelado esta com o valor False e mesmo assim esta ocorrendo a troca, precisamos do XML de retorno dessa consulta pois o mesmo deve estar sendo gerado de forma errada pela SEFAZ.
  22. Bom dia a todos, Acredito que até o final desta semana será enviado para o SVN diversas correções.
  23. Bom dia Flavio, Já fiz a alteração da forma correta e ainda esta semana vou enviar para o SVN.
  24. Bom dia Paulo, Já enviei a sua contribuição para o SVN.
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.